About

English film director known for his work on classic 1950s films with stars like Marilyn Monroe and Robert Ryan. His first two films The Weaker Sex and Paper Orchid caught the attention of American film directors and brought him to Hollywood, where he directed Golden Globe-winning films like A Night to Remember.

Before Fame

He studied in both France and the City of London School. His first film position was for Gainsborough Pictures, a British film company. 

Trivia

During World War II, he was a production manager and director of documentaries for the military.

Family Life

He married Muriel Bradford ​ ​ in 1940, divorced four years later, and then married Joan Dixon in 1948 but divorced in 1984. He had a son with his second wife. 

Associated With

In 1938, he was the assistant director to Alfred Hitchcock on the film The Lady Vanishes.
